2. Sensorparing

The main unit should automatically connect to the sensors once batteries are installed. If a sensor does not connect, or if you need to re-establish connection:

  1. Ensure both the main unit and the sensor are powered on and within range.
  2. On the main unit, press the "CH/+" button to select the desired channel (1 or 2) for the sensor you wish to reconnect.
  3. Press and hold the "CH/+" button for approximately 3 seconds. The main unit will attempt to reconnect to the selected sensor. The signal icon for that channel will flash until a connection is established.

4. Setting Temperature Alarms (MAX/MIN)

The thermometer allows you to set upper (MAX) and lower (MIN) temperature limits for each channel. An audible alarm will sound if the temperature goes outside these set limits.

  1. Press and hold the "ALARM" button for 3 seconds. The MAX alarm value will flash.
  2. Use the "CH/+" or "CLEAR/-" buttons to adjust the MAX temperature limit.
  3. Press the "ALARM" button again to confirm the MAX setting and proceed to the MIN alarm setting. The MIN alarm value will flash.
  4. Use the "CH/+" or "CLEAR/-" buttons to adjust the MIN temperature limit.
  5. Press the "ALARM" button once more to confirm the MIN setting and exit alarm setting mode. The display will return to normal operation.

5. Viewing MAX/MIN Records

The main unit records the maximum and minimum temperatures detected by each sensor and its own ambient sensor.

  • In normal mode, press the "MAX/MIN" button once to display the maximum recorded temperatures for all channels.
  • Press the "MAX/MIN" button again to display the minimum recorded temperatures for all channels.
  • Press the "MAX/MIN" button a third time to return to the current temperature display.

6. Clearing MAX/MIN Records and Switching 24H/ALL TIME

To clear the MAX/MIN records or switch between 24-hour and all-time records:

  • In normal mode, press and hold the "CLEAR/-" button for 3 seconds. This will clear the MAX/MIN records and switch the display between 24-hour and all-time recording modes.
